Electronics Assembly Operative required Redhill
Salary: £27,000 - £28,000 per annum (dependent on experience)
Hours: 40 hours per week (8:00 AM - 5:00 PM Monday to Thursday, 8:00 AM - 4:00 PM Friday)
About the RoleAn exciting opportunity has arisen with a top-tier, global manufacturer of high-precision testing systems. Following a recent high-profile acquisition of innovative technology, they are experiencing significant growth in their cutting-edge product range.
Key Responsibilities
Assembly & Build: Construct and assemble the specialized range of products in strict accordance with company build procedures and quality standards.
Calibration Support: Assist with the calibration of completed products using specialized equipment, accurately recording serial numbers, production data, and test records.
Inspection & Kitting: Perform incoming parts inspections to ensure quality control, and kit parts from production orders for sub-assemblies.
Logistics & Packing: Pack finished products to fulfill customer orders, ensuring items are securely readied for on-time shipping.
Systems & Admin: Utilize the company ERP system (Microsoft Dynamics) to maintain accurate production files and ensure the workflow runs smoothly.Requirements & Experience
Education/Qualifications: NVQ, HNC, HND, or an apprenticeship in Mechanical/Electronic Engineering (or a relevant technical discipline). Product assembly training in a stringent manufacturing environment is highly desirable.
Technical Skillset: Strong practical skills with the ability to read and interpret engineering/general assembly drawings. Experienced in using small hand tools and precision measuring equipment (e.g., micrometers, verniers).
Key Attributes: Excellent attention to detail, strong communication skills, and a flexible, team-oriented attitude. A personal interest or hobby in 3D printing, RC models, or DIY mechanics fits perfectly with the culture of this team.
